Rowell scores 13 in men's basketball loss to Roanoke

DANVILLE, Va. — Averett University men's basketball dropped a home conference game 70-50 to Roanoke College on Wednesday night in the Grant Center.

Roanoke (13-2, 6-0 ODAC), which is receiving votes in the D3hoops.com poll, used a 16-2 run midway through the first half to go in front 27-16 after Averett (6-10, 2-5 ODAC) led for almost the first seven and a half minutes of the game. The Cougars got back within six before the Maroons extended their advantage to 35-24 at the break.

The Maroons continued to grow their lead throughout the second half as they pulled away to remain unbeaten in league play.

Averett got 13 points off the bench from senior Jalen Rowell, as well as a team-high 10 rebounds from senior Bryson McLaughlin, who chipped in seven points. Sophomore Bryce Shaw added nine points and junior Jason Sellars II had eight points and six boards for the Cougars.

Averett outrebounded Roanoke 39-32.

The Cougars travel to face No. 21 Guilford College on Saturday at 2 p.m.
